Kind: Interface

Source: packages/microservices/interfaces/custom-transport-strategy.interface.ts

Part of: Microservices

CustomTransportStrategy identifies a custom microservice transport implementation through its transportId. It is used by the microservices layer to distinguish custom transport strategies from built-in transports and route configuration or lifecycle handling to the correct implementation.

Properties

PropertyType
transportIdTransportId

Usage

ts
import { CustomTransportStrategy } from '@nestjs/microservices';
import { Transport } from '@nestjs/microservices/enums/transport.enum';

class RedisStreamsTransportStrategy implements CustomTransportStrategy {
  transportId = Transport.REDIS;

  listen(callback: () => void) {
    // Start the custom transport server.
    callback();
  }

  close() {
    // Release transport resources.
  }
}

const strategy = new RedisStreamsTransportStrategy();

// Pass the strategy to your microservice configuration as needed.
console.log(strategy.transportId);
